Activity Of Different Soybean In Trypsin And Lectin And Their Effect On The Rat

Sixty mice aged fifty days were randomly divided into six groups (A, B , C , D , E , F) with each group involved 10 replicates.Group A-E were regarded as experimental group, and were fed on the experimental diets containing Jilinxiaoli6, Jilin30, Jilin45, Jinong7 and Feijiao7607, respectively. Control group F was fed on the controlled diet containing soybean meal and oil. The effect of growth and metabolism on the mice were studied by the feeding trial, digesting experiment. The whole experiment was divided into pre-experimental period and experimental period. During pre-experimental period, which lasted one week, the main purpose was to let the mice adapt the environment and to find out the appetite of them in order to raise them on limited diets. Experimental period began from the second week, collecting excrement and urine every day until nine days . Five kinds of methods were adopted in this experiment, namely, the Smith modified law , Kakade law , Smith law , Hamerstrand law and Liu method to examine soybean trypsin inhibitor activity, and lectin result price method was adopted to examine the content of lectin in soybeans.The result of the activity of soybean trypsin inhibitor factors showed that the activity by different methods were different. For example, that of Jilin Xiaoli 6 was 25.13mg/g by Smith modified method, 19.335mg/g by Kakade, 24.065mg/g by Smith, 18.34mg/g by Hamerstrand, 32.79mg/g by Liu. Therefore, the result of the activity of trypsin inhibitor with Pig trypsin is higher than that with bovine trypsin. The results from Liu were higher than others, but there was not significant difference among them. In addition, the results from Smith modified method and Kakade were the same, so was that from Smith and Hamerstrand except the order of Jilin Xiaoli 6 and Jinong 7.The results of Liu were different from those of the other four methods, and higher than that of the other four methods.The result of content of lectin showed the order was JilinXiaoli6(640units/g), Jinong7(250units/g),fengjiao7607(l 90units/g),Jilin45(l 80units/g), Jilin30(l 50units/g).The result of the digesting experiment indicated, digestion rate of dry materials, crude protein and non-nitrogen extrat of group F were the highest, digestion rate of dry material, crude protein in group C were the lowest, so was that of non-nitrogen exact in group D. The result of digestion of dry materials showed, difference among the groups were not significant(P>0.05), but different among A, C, D were significant (P < 0.05) and their result were lower than F. The result of digestion of CP showed, the difference between B and C was significant (P < 0.05 ) and their result were lower than D,E. The result of digestion of Non-nitrogen extract showed, differences among A,B,C,E, among B,C,D,E, among A,F were not significant (P>0.05). But difference between A and D was significant (P < 0.05) , so was between D and F. The result of digestion of CF showed that group D was the highest, contrary to group F, but difference among groupswas not significant (P>0.05),but significant between experimental groups and contrast group. The result of digestion of CA showed, among A, B , E , F, among B , C , E , F, among D , F, the difference was not significant (P>0.05).The result of digestion of CF showed, difference between test group and contrast group was not significant (P> 0.05), and group B was the highest, yet C was the lowest.The results of relevant analysis between the digestion rate of the diets and the activity of soybean trypsin and lectin indicated that negative correlation were showed between the digestion rate of DM,CP,NFE and the activity of soybean trypsin and lectin , and the rate of DM and CP digestion showed significantly negative correlation compared to Liu method (P < 0.05 ) , and the coefficient correlation is respectively -0.869 sum -0.864.
